This work presents an incisive critique of contemporary culture and religion. How can Christians experience and create a rich, satisfying spiritual and cultural life in a spiritually, intellectually, and creatively impoverished age? Award-winning broadcaster and writer Dick Staub concludes that though it is influential, American popular culture is generally superficial, spiritually delusional, and soulless. He shows that American Christianity has similarly devolved into its own mindless, diversionary, and celebrity-driven superficiality - and tells Christians what they can do about it. Dick Staub (Shoreline, WA) is a writer and speaker whose work focuses on understanding faith and culture and interpreting each to the other.
